Solving Wicked Problems with Action Learning
The Action Learning Institute presented a seminar to an AME group on Action Learning at the Manufacturing Technologies Centre on Tuesday 24th of October.
The session was well attended with general manufacturing, food manufacturing, aged care and education industries represented. Dan Moriarty and Bob Cother presented some recent case studies from Robern Menz, Spring Gully Pickles and Rossi boots. The Action Learning Institute process was discussed in detail which helped attendees to understand the power of action learning and the ALI process in particular.
This was followed by a brief workshop where the attendees split into two groups and discussed potential “Wicked Problems” in their respective organisations and developed problem statements through questioning from “fresh eyes” on the problem.
